The History of Guster Tickers

Word-of-mouth is all Guster has needed to achieve a considerable amount of success in the rock band industry. Known as having a "grassroots" fan base, Guster has gone on to achieve both popular and commercial success.

This Indie rock trio began as an acoustic trio in 1991, whose members met during their freshmen year at Tufts University. They spent most of their college years in the 1990s touring colleges, selling Guster tickets, and releasing independent albums. Their first independent album, Parachute, was released in 1994, and a second album, Goldfly, was released in 1996.

Guster secured a contract with Sire Records and reissued Goldfly in 1998. Guster then began work on their next album - arguably considered their breakthrough album - Lost and Gone Forever in 1999, and a follow-up album just a year later. Lost and Gone Forever finally reached the Billboard charts, and the band achieved mainstream success with their hit single, "Fa Fa," which reached number 26 on the Adult Top 40 charts.

The band began using percussionist and drum sounds, thanks to the addition of band member Brian Rosenworcel, and after multi-instrumentalist Joe Pisapia joined the group in 2003, Guster began to explore folk, rock and pop sounds.

Their next studio album, Keep it Together, produced a more evolved sound with drum kit percussion and numerous contributions from instrumentalist Joe Pisapia. This album, which was released in 2003, finally cracked the Top 40 on the Billboard charts.

Guster released their 2004 concert album, Guster on Ice, and then returned to the studio in 2006 with their album, Ganging up on the Sun.

Guster released their sixth studio album, Easy Wonderful, in October 2010.

Guster Tickets: What to Expect

Guster, which has gone from a grassroots, Indie band to achieve a considerable amount of commercial success, has never strayed too far from their original sound of dreamy songs about love, self-doubt and the rock start life.

Often considered a mix of roots rock, folk and experimental pop, Guster has a talent for writing infectious songs and using unlikely instruments, such as acoustic guitars and a bongo set, to develop their own, unique sound.
